ワードVBA学習におすすめのサイトと勉強法

このQ&Aのポイント
  • ワードVBA学習に役立つサイトや本を紹介します。また、ワードVBA初心者におすすめの勉強法も教えます。
  • ワードVBAの学習には、参考になるサイトや書籍があります。初心者向けの勉強法も紹介します。
  • ワードVBAを学ぶためのおすすめサイトや本を紹介します。初心者向けの勉強法も解説します。
回答を見る
  • ベストアンサー

ワードVBAを学習したいのですが、お勧めサイトはありますか

ワードVBAを学習したいのですが、参考になるサイト(本)をお勧めください。 今、作りたいのは 一つ目のコマンドボタンを使用した場合に、その設定した場所に本日日付を挿入することと 二つ目のコマンドボタンを使用した場合に、その設定した場所に任意の日付を挿入することと(カレンダーコントロールや、リストボックスが併用できたらいいと思っています。ここの日付は予定日なので、数日先や数週間先、もしくは数ヶ月先が入ります) これらの日付けは、後日ファイルを開けたときに日付が更新しないように、テキストとして入力したいのです。 また、オプションボタンを3つ配置して、指定の箇所に○印をつけるということをしたいのです。 1つ目のオプションボタンを選択したら、指定の箇所(全部で3箇所)のうち3箇所全てに○印をつけ、 2つ目のオプションボタンを選択したら、指定の箇所(全部で3箇所)のうち最初の1つ目を除く2箇所に○印をつけ、 3つ目のオプションボタンを選択したら、指定の箇所(全部で3箇所)のうち最初の2つを除き、最後の1箇所に○印をつけるというものです。 初心者ですが、お勧めの勉強法がありましたら、教えてください。 よろしく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• shintaro-2
  • ベストアンサー率36% (2266/6244)
回答No.1

>初心者ですが、お勧めの勉強法がありましたら、教えてください。 wordのバージョンにもよりますが  私は本をお勧めします 10日でおぼえるWord VBA入門教室―97/98/2000対応 (単行本) 大野 悟 (著), アトラス出版企画 (著) http://www.amazon.co.jp/10%E6%97%A5%E3%81%A7%E3%81%8A%E3%81%BC%E3%81%88%E3%82%8BWord-VBA%E5%85%A5%E9%96%80%E6%95%99%E5%AE%A4%E2%80%9597-98-2000%E5%AF%BE%E5%BF%9C-%E5%A4%A7%E9%87%8E/dp/4881357891/ref=sr_1_2/249-8367789-8493164?ie=UTF8&s=books&qid=1187339181&sr=1-2 オフィスの達人〈5〉VBA活用術―Excel/Word/Access/PowerPoint/Outlook Office 2003対応 (オフィスの達人 (5)) (単行本)  佐野 昂成 (著) http://www.amazon.co.jp/%E3%82%AA%E3%83%95%E3%82%A3%E3%82%B9%E3%81%AE%E9%81%94%E4%BA%BA%E3%80%885%E3%80%89VBA%E6%B4%BB%E7%94%A8%E8%A1%93%E2%80%95Excel-Access-PowerPoint-Outlook-%E3%82%AA%E3%83%95%E3%82%A3%E3%82%B9%E3%81%AE%E9%81%94%E4%BA%BA/dp/4839916055/ref=sr_1_1/249-8367789-8493164?ie=UTF8&s=books&qid=1187339181&sr=1-1

pocorino
質問者

お礼

ありがとうございます。 ワードの対応バージョンが古い点が気にかかりましたが、おそらくそれ以降は出版されていないのでしょうね。 中古本が定価の倍以上の値段なので手が出づらいので、新品で本屋さんで買えたら購入しようと思います。 有難うございました。

関連するQ&A

  • Wordの貼り付けオプションについて

    WindowsXPでWord2002を使っています。 文字をコピーして他の場所に貼り付けたときに 貼り付けオプションボタンがでてきますが、 その中の「貼り付け先の書式に合わせる」コマンドを使うと 貼り付け先の書式にあうはずなのに、 太字、斜体、下線は設定されたままになってしまいます。 これはバグなんでしょうか? どなたか教えてください。

  • エクセル2007VBAでコマンドボタンのプロパティ表示

    いつもお世話になります。最近エクセル2007でVBAを使うようになりました。フォームコントロールからコマンドボタンを挿入したのですが、コマンドボタンのプロパティを表示しようとしても表示できません。2003では表示できます。2003では、コマンドボタンを選択して右クリック→プロパティでEnabledやVisibleを設定できました。2007ではどうすればコマンドボタンのプロパティを表示できるのでしょうか?

  • VBAを覚えたいのですがさっぱりわかりません、初心者です。

    VBAを覚えたいのですがさっぱりわかりません、初心者です。 VBAを活用したいと思っておりますが、実際作るとなると、 何から覚えれば良いのか?何から作成していけば良いのか分かりません。 単純にエクセルから「Visual Basic Editor」を選択し、 ユーザーフォームの挿入からフォームやコマンドボックスを使用して動作画面を作成し、 コマンドボタンを押したら『if文』などを入力していけば良いと考えていたのですが、 特に”マクロ”についてさっぱり分かりません。 サイトで検索をして内容を読んでも本を読んでも、載っていることは出来ても、 自分がしたいことについては良く分からず、 『一番最初に何をすれば良いのか』すら分かりません。 文章の「起・承・転・結」ではありませんが、 どのように段階を経て作成していくのが一番分かり易いのでしょうか?

  • Wordのコンテンツコントロールについて

    よろしくお願い致します。 Word文書の中に、「日付選択コンテンツコントロール」を挿入しました。 日付の表示形式は、「ggge年M月d日(aaa)」を設定しました。 これを使用すると、日付の中の数字は、「半角」で表示されます。 この数字を最初から「全角」で表示したいと思います。 最初から「全角」が無理なら、できるだけ簡単に変換できる方法を教えていただきたいです。 Windows 7 Word 2010 よろしくお願いいたします。

  • Word2003でヘッダーとフッターの日付について

    ヘッダーに日付を入れる際、ヘッダーフッターツールバーより「日付の挿入」ボタンをクリックすれば、2006/7/4と表示されますが、これをデリートして、再度、日付の挿入ボタンをクリックしたところ、7/4/2006 というように、なぜか西暦が最後に表示されました。最初の 2006/7/4という表示に戻そうと、一旦、ファイルを閉じて、再度、開きもう一度日付の挿入ボタンで直りましたが、閉じる→開くをせずに、直す方法は、手入力しかないのでしょうか?デリートして、再度、日付の挿入ボタンをクリックしたら、なぜ西暦の順番が逆になってしまうのかが、不思議です。。どなたか教えてください。お願いします。

  • 【EXCEL2002】「貼り付け先の書式に合わせる」をVBAで実行したい

    助けてください。 HTMLの表データを貼り付けているのですが、 「1/1」とかって記載されたデータが日付形式に変換されてしまいます。 貼り付けのあとに出てくる「貼り付けオプション」で 「貼り付け先の書式に合わせる」を使えばうまく貼り付けられたのですが、 このコマンドをVBAで実施するにはどうすればいいでしょうか? (貼り付けるデータが大量なため、マウスで選択だときついのです) 「貼り付け先の書式に合わせる」はマウスでの選択のため、 VBAの記録だと、覚えられないのです。 このコマンドがVBAで選択できればすごい楽になるのですが。 ご存知の方教えてください。

  • VBAのコマンドボタンについて

    エクセルVBAのコマンドボタンをシートに配置してあるのですが、セルの操作(他シートからのコピペ)によってそれの大きさが変わらないようにしたいです。 コマンドボタンのオプションで、『セルに合わせて移動やサイズ変更をしない』にチェックをいれてあるのですが、他のシートからコピペした際にコマンドボタンの位置とサイズが変わってしまいます。 コピーする元のシートのセルサイズに引きずられて、大きさが変わってしまいます(値だけコピーにすれば大丈夫)。 元に戻すボタンを押してもコマンドボタンの大きさは元に戻ってくれないので困っています。 シートの保護で行と列の大きさを保つように保護することも試みたのですが、それだとコピペができなくなってしまいました。 コピペした際に コマンドボタンの大きさと位置が変わらなければどんな方法でも大丈夫です。 (1)コマンドボタンの設定のミス?なので設定を変更する (2)常時、「形式を選択して貼り付ける」の際に"値のみ"しか選べないようにする(もしくは単に「貼り付け」した時に値だけ貼り付けるように設定する)、 (3)行と列の高さ・幅の変更を禁止したままコピペ等が出来るようにする ・・・などなど 詳しい方よろしくお願いします。

  • Excel VBAについて

    Excelのシートにコマンドボタンを配置して、そのコマンドボタンをクリックすると「ファイルを開く」のダイアログボックスを表示したいと思っています。 そのとき、デフォルトでファイルの場所は「D:\Test」にしたいのですが、どうしたらよいのでしょうか。 ユーザは、ファイルの場所を探さずに、コマンドボタンをクリックしたら開きたいファイル名を指定するだけでいいようにしたいのですが。 下記では、ファイルを開くダイアログは表示されるのですが、ファイルの場所を毎回探さなくてはいけません。 どなたかご教授下さい。 Private Sub Cmd_ファイル選択_Click() Dim FileName As Variant FileName=Application.GetOpenFileName("Microsoft Excelブック,*.xls") Workbooks.Open OpenFileName End Sub

  • AccessVBAでオプションボタン・グループについて

    複数のオプションボタンを1つのオプショングループに設定し、選択されたボタンによって変数を変えて処理を実行するツールを作成しています。 選択されたオプションボタンのラベル前景色を変更したいのですが、うまくいきません。 各オプションボタンのフォーカス取得時・喪失時に変更させると次の処理(コマンドボタン)に移ったときに色が変わってしまいます。 オプショングループのvalue値によってラベル色を指定することは可能でしょうか? 説明がわかりづらくてすみません。宜しくお願いいたします。

  • ワード2007の読み上げ

    ワード2007に読み上げ機能が有ると聞いたのですが、「ワードオプション」、「ユーザー設定」、「すべてのコマンド」の中にコマンドが無いのですがほかの場所に有るのでしょうかお教え下さい。 尚エクセル2007の読み上げは可能ですが英語になっています。 どうか宜しくお願い致します。

専門家に質問してみよう